    pET29a载体基本信息

    出品公司: EMD Biosciences (Novagen)
    别名: pET29a, pet 29a
    质粒类型: 大肠杆菌蛋白表达
    表达水平:
    克隆方法: 多克隆位点,限制性内切酶
    载体大小: 5371 bp
    5' 测序引物: T7
    5' 测序引物序列: 5'-TAATACGACTCACTATAGGG-3'
    载体标签: N-S, N-Thrombin, C-His
    载体抗性: Kanamycin
    表达宿主菌: BL21(DE3) 、BLR(DE3)、BL21(DE3)pLysS
    备注:
    N term thrombin cleavage site; a,b,c vary by MCS;

    pET29a载体简介

    The pET-29a-c(+) vectors carry an N-terminal S•Tag™/thrombin configuration plus an optional C-terminal His•Tag® sequence. Unique sites are shown on the circle map. Note that the sequence is numbered by the pBR322 convention, so the T7 expression region is reversed on the circular map. The cloning/expression region of the coding strand transcribed by T7 RNA polymerase is shown below. The f1 origin is oriented so that infection with helper phage will produce virions containing single-stranded DNA that corresponds to the coding strand. Therefore, single-stranded sequencing should be performed using the T7 terminator primer (Cat. No.69337-3).
